What are the Early Warning Signs of Pancreatic Cancer?

pancreatic

Pancreatic cancer is a type of cancer that occurs when malignant cells develop in the tissues of the pancreas, a gland located in the abdomen that plays a vital role in digestion and blood sugar regulation. It is a particularly deadly form of cancer, with a five-year survival rate of only around 10%. Unfortunately, pancreatic cancer is often difficult to detect early because it often does not cause symptoms until it has spread to other body parts. 

However, recognizing the early warning signs of pancreatic cancer can help increase the chances of early detection, leading to better treatment options and improved outcomes. Understanding Pancreatic Cancer

Your pancreas measures around 6 inches (15 centimeters) in length and resembles a pear that has been turned on its side. To assist your body in metabolizing the sugar in the foods you eat, it releases (secretes) hormones like insulin. It also creates digestive fluids to aid food digestion and nutritional absorption.

The Pancreas and Its Functions

The pancreas produces enzymes that break down food in the digestive system and produce hormones such as insulin that regulate blood sugar levels. It is located deep in the abdomen, behind the stomach.

Types of Pancreatic Cancer

Two main types of pancreatic cancer are :

-Exocrine tumors

-Endocrine tumors

Exocrine tumors, which account for about 95% of cases, develop in the cells that produce enzymes for digestion. Endocrine tumors, or pancreatic neuroendocrine tumors (PNETs), develop in the cells that produce hormones.

Origin of Pancreatic Cancer

When cells in your pancreas experience DNA changes (mutations), pancreatic cancer results. The instructions that inform a cell what to do are encoded in its DNA. The cells are instructed by these mutations to grow uncontrollably and to live on after normal cells would expire. A tumor may develop from these cells as they gather.

Causes and Development of Pancreatic Cancer

The main cause of pancreatic cancer is still unknown, but several risk factors have been identified. These include age, family history, smoking and tobacco use, obesity and poor diet, chronic pancreatitis, and diabetes.

  • The Benefits of Early Detection

Early detection of pancreatic cancer can greatly increase the chances of successful treatment. When pancreatic cancer is caught early, it is more likely to be localized and easier to treat. Patients with early-stage pancreatic cancer have a much higher survival rate than those with advanced-stage disease.

  • Challenges in Early Detection of Pancreatic Cancer

One of the challenges in the early detection of pancreatic cancer is that the early stages of the disease often do not cause any symptoms. Cancer may have already spread to other body parts when symptoms appear, making it more difficult to treat.

  • The Role of Screening in Early Detection

Screening tests, such as imaging studies and blood tests, can help detect pancreatic cancer before symptoms appear. However, there is no standard screening test for pancreatic cancer, and screening is generally only recommended for people at high risk for the disease.

Common Early Warning Signs

  • Jaundice

It is a condition where the skin and eyes become yellow due to a buildup of bilirubin in the body. This can be a sign of pancreatic cancer if the tumor is located in the head of the pancreas, where it can block the bile duct.

  • Abdominal Pain

Abdominal pain is one of the common symptoms of pancreatic cancer. The pain can be felt in the upper part of the abdomen and may be severe or constant.

  • Unexplained Weight Loss

Unexplained weight loss can occur even if the person is eating normally. It is also a common symptom of pancreatic cancer.

  • Loss of Appetite

Loss of appetite is another symptom of pancreatic cancer and can be caused by a combination of factors, including pain and nausea.

  • Digestive Issues

Pancreatic cancer can cause digestive issues such as nausea, vomiting, diarrhea, and constipation.

  • Back Pain

Back pain is a usual symptom if the tumor is located in the body or the pancreas tail.

Risk Factors for Pancreatic Cancer

risk factors for pancreatic cancer

  1. Age: The risk of having pancreatic cancer increases with age, with most cases occurring in people over 60.
  2. Family History: Those with a family history of pancreatic cancer have a higher risk of developing the disease.

  3. Smoking and Tobacco Use: Smoking and tobacco use are major risk factors for pancreatic cancer, with smokers being two to three times more likely to develop the disease than non-smokers.

  4. Obesity and Poor Diet: Obesity and a poor diet high in fat and processed foods are linked to an increased risk of pancreatic cancer.

  5. Chronic pancreatitis: Pancreas inflammation for a prolonged time can escalate the risk of developing pancreatic cancer.

  6. Diabetes: People with diabetes are at a slightly higher risk of developing pancreatic cancer.
